Project Engineer Jobs in Arizona
A Project Engineer in the construction industry is responsible for overseeing, coordinating, and managing the technical aspects of a construction project. This includes reviewing designs and drawings, ensuring compliance with safety and building codes, preparing project schedules, and managing project resources. They work closely with Project Managers, Architects, and other Engineers to ensure successful project execution from conception to completion. They are also responsible for troubleshooting technical issues that arise during the construction process.
Important skills for a Project Engineer include strong technical knowledge in engineering and construction, excellent problem-solving abilities, and effective communication skills. They should be proficient in using project management and CAD software. Relevant certifications could include a Project Management Professional (PMP) certification or Certified Construction Manager (CCM). Prior roles a person may have before becoming a Project Engineer include Field Engineer, Assistant Project Manager, or Design Engineer.
